House in Umenoki
Hidekazu Kishi Architects
- Outline
- The designer's own residence for a family of three stands in a residential area where fields and houses are intermingled. A group of small rooms surround the living space in the center of the site with gaps between them, and several small roofs float in the air. The house is intertwined with its surroundings, which are a mixture of various uses and volumes, with a community meeting hall on the northwest side and a newly built apartment building adjacent on the northeast side.
